Server Side Image Processing Tools

I’m in the process of coding a gallery script for my own site, but in the meantime, I need to get a user-submission gallery working on my class’s Mambo homepage.

I’ve tried several (currently Zoom Gallery), that all seem to require ‘external’ image processing utilities beyond what PHP provides.

Zoom is supposed to support NetPBM, IM, GD1, and GD2, none of which it’s able to autodetect. Without troubling my host, is there any way to check for the presence/location of any of these?

If they aren’t there, is there any way to add one of them, having access only to the server only by FTP and a login-panel?
